California State University, San Bernardino (CSUSB) is known for offering a wide array of both undergraduate and graduate programs. In terms of popular undergraduate majors, some of the standouts include:
1. Business Administration: Offering concentrations in areas such as marketing, management, information systems management, and human resource management. Many students appreciate this broad coverage as it gives them flexibility in tailoring their education to align with their specific interests and career goals.
2. Psychology: The program is often praised for its focus on practical applications of psychological theories, not to mention offering opportunities for students to engage in research and community service.
3. Sociology: CSUSB's sociology program has been complimented for its emphasis on experiential and service learning, typically offering a thorough grounding in both classic and contemporary sociological theory.
4. Criminal Justice: Promising a multidisciplinary approach, covering criminological theory, the development of law, the adjudication process, and the nature of crime.
5. Nursing: CSUSB has a well-regarded nursing program that prepares students for demanding healthcare settings.
6. Computer Science: This program provides a strong foundation in both theoretical concepts and practical skills, which is advantageous in a rapidly evolving industry.
Please remember these are just a few of the popular majors at CSUSB and the university offers many other programs that may be well-suited to your interests and career goals.
